学编程学到什么程度才可工作

fiy 其他 7

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学编程到能够独立完成项目并且有一定的实际工作经验,才能够找到编程相关的工作。具体来说,以下是学编程需要达到的程度才可工作的几个方面:

    1. 熟悉编程语言和基础知识:首先,要选择一门主流的编程语言,例如Python、Java或C++,并且掌握其基本语法和常用的数据结构与算法。此外,还需要了解计算机的基本原理和操作系统的基本知识。

    2. 掌握软件开发工具和技术:学习使用常见的集成开发环境(IDE)和版本控制工具(如Git),并且了解常用的开发框架和库。同时,要掌握面向对象编程(OOP)和软件设计模式等软件开发的基本概念和方法。

    3. 解决问题的能力:编程工作中最重要的能力之一是解决问题的能力。这包括分析问题、提出解决方案、实施和调试代码,并进行测试和优化。要学会使用调试工具和技术,以及查找和理解相关文档和资源。

    4. 实践经验和项目经验:仅仅学习编程知识是不够的,还需要通过实践和完成项目来提升自己的能力。可以参与开源项目、参加编程比赛或者自己独立完成一些小型的项目,这样可以积累实践经验,并且在面试时能够展示自己的能力。

    5. 沟通和团队合作能力:在实际工作中,编程人员通常需要与其他人员(如产品经理、设计师、测试人员等)进行沟通和协作。因此,良好的沟通和团队合作能力也是非常重要的。

    总而言之,学编程到能够独立完成项目、具有一定实践经验,并且具备解决问题、沟通和团队合作能力时,就可以开始寻找编程相关的工作了。但需要注意的是,编程是一个不断学习和进步的过程,工作中仍然需要不断学习新的知识和技术。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习编程可以帮助人们进入计算机科学和软件开发领域,并且有很多不同的工作岗位可供选择。然而,要达到能够从事编程工作的水平,需要掌握一定的技能和知识。以下是学习编程并能够开始工作的程度:

    1. 掌握基本编程概念和语法:学习编程的第一步是了解基本的编程概念,如变量、条件语句、循环和函数等。还需要学习一种或多种编程语言的语法,如Python、Java、C++等。

    2. 理解算法和数据结构:学习编程需要掌握算法和数据结构的基本知识。算法是解决问题的步骤和方法,而数据结构是组织和存储数据的方式。掌握这些概念可以帮助你编写更高效和可维护的代码。

    3. 解决问题的能力:编程是解决问题的过程,需要具备良好的问题解决能力。这包括分析问题、设计解决方案、调试代码和测试等。通过解决实际问题来提高这些技能。

    4. 实践项目经验:除了理论知识,实践项目经验也是成为一名合格程序员的关键。可以通过参与开源项目、完成个人项目或实习等方式来积累项目经验。这些经验可以帮助你熟悉实际开发流程和工具,并展示你的能力。

    5. 深入学习特定领域:一旦掌握了基本的编程技能,可以选择深入学习特定的领域,如前端开发、后端开发、移动应用开发、数据分析等。这样可以在特定领域中获得更深入的知识和技能,并提高就业竞争力。

    需要注意的是,学习编程是一个不断学习和发展的过程。工作中可能会遇到新的挑战和技术需求,因此持续学习和不断提升自己的能力是必要的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学编程到什么程度才能开始工作是一个常见的问题,但实际上没有一个固定的答案。这取决于你想从事什么样的编程工作以及你的目标和雇主的要求。然而,以下是一些常见的学习程度和技能,可能会让你有更好的就业机会:

    1. 掌握一门编程语言:开始学习一门编程语言,如Python、Java、C++等。掌握其中一门语言,可以让你有能力编写简单的程序,并能够理解和修改其他人编写的代码。

    2. 理解编程基础知识:了解基本的编程概念,如变量、循环、条件语句等。了解这些基础知识,可以让你理解和编写简单的程序,并能够解决一些常见的编程问题。

    3. 掌握数据结构和算法:学习和理解数据结构和算法是成为一名优秀程序员的关键。掌握常见的数据结构(如数组、链表、栈、队列等)和算法(如排序、查找、递归等),可以让你更有效地解决问题,并能够编写高效的代码。

    4. 实践项目经验:除了理论知识,实践项目经验也是很重要的。通过参与实际的编程项目,你可以学习如何应用你所学的知识,解决实际的问题,并与其他开发人员合作。

    5. 学会使用开发工具和框架:学习使用一些常见的开发工具和框架,如IDE(集成开发环境)、版本控制系统(如Git)、测试框架等。这些工具和框架可以提高你的开发效率,并且在一些工作岗位上是必备的技能。

    6. 持续学习和跟进技术发展:编程是一个不断发展的领域,新的技术和工具不断涌现。持续学习和跟进技术发展,可以让你保持竞争力,并适应不断变化的工作环境。

    总而言之,学编程并没有一个明确的终点,因为技术在不断发展。然而,通过掌握基本的编程知识和技能,并不断实践和学习,你可以提高自己的就业竞争力,找到适合自己的编程工作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部